Abstract
The invention discloses an embedded intelligent mirror cabinet. A mirror is embedded into the middle of the front side of a cabinet body, a placement plate is installed on the portion, in the middle of the back side of the mirror, of the inner wall of the cabinet body, a notch is formed in the portion, corresponding to the edge of the outer surface of the placement plate, of the inner wall of thecabinet body, positioning blocks are welded to the top and the bottom of the inner wall of the notch respectively, positioning grooves are formed in the portions, corresponding to the edges of the outer surfaces of the positioning blocks, of the top and the bottom of the placement plate respectively, and partition plates are arranged in the middle of the inner wall of the placement plate at equalintervals. The embedded intelligent mirror cabinet is scientific and reasonable in structure and safe and convenient to use; through the positioning blocks, the placement plate, the positioning grooves, a lighting lamp, the partition plates and a dehumidification box, the lighting lamp can be easily disassembled, the disassembly difficulty of the lighting lamp is reduced, the lighting lamp is easily maintained, and the maintenance difficulty of the lighting lamp is reduced. Besides, by using the dehumidification box, the dampness on the placement plate is reduced, the lighting lamp is furtherprotected, and the service life of the lighting lamp is prolonged.
Description
technical field [0001] The invention relates to the technical field of mirror cabinets, in particular to an embedded intelligent mirror cabinet. Background technique [0002] Mirror cabinets are widely used in people's daily life, both for dressing up and for storage. However, the supplementary lighting of existing mirror cabinets is embedded and exposed on the glass surface or around the glass surface. It solves the problem of supplementary light caused by insufficient light in the daily use of the mirror cabinet, but the exposed supplementary light makes the mirror cabinet not beautiful enough. For this reason, a Chinese patent discloses a smart mirror cabinet. The authorized announcement number is CN 208957885 U. The patent is hidden in The fill light on the back of the mirror can not only solve the problem of insufficient light, but also ensure the overall aesthetics of the mirror cabinet when the fill light is turned off, improving the user experience; [0003] However...
